Cornbread Loaf

INGREDIENTS

2 cups white or yellow cornmeal
1/2 cup flour
1/2 cup sugar
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
2 tablespoons shortening
2 cups buttermilk

Sift dry ingredients. Place shortening in a loaf pan and set in a preheated 350 degree oven to melt.

Combine flour and cornmeal and remaining dry ingredients. Pour buttermilk into dry mixture and stir to moisten. Lastly pour in the melted shortening, you can use butter, and mix.

Return mixture to hot pan and bake at 350 degrees for about 1 hour or until tests done.

Slice medium thick and serve warm with butter.

NOTE - Be sure the pan is well coated with the hot oil before you pour it into the cornbread mixture.
